2009 Chevrolet Optra vs. 2009 Mazda BT-50

To start off, both 2009 Chevrolet Optra and 2009 Mazda BT-50 were released in the same year (2009).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,953 cc (4 cylinders), 2009 Mazda BT-50 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Mazda BT-50 (154 HP @ 3200 RPM) has 34 more horse power than 2009 Chevrolet Optra. (120 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Mazda BT-50 should accelerate faster than 2009 Chevrolet Optra.

Because 2009 Mazda BT-50 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 Chevrolet Optra.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Mazda BT-50 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Mazda BT-50 (380 Nm @ 180 RPM) has 214 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Chevrolet Optra. (166 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2009 Mazda BT-50 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Chevrolet Optra.
